Dataset for article "Prediction of thermal shock induced cracking in multi-material ceramics using a stress-energy criterion" published in Engineering Fracture Mechanics
Authors/Creators
Description
Dataset contains graphical outputs of the numerical analysis performed using Finite element method in finite elements software Ansys Mechanical. It contains also photoes of the tested specimens. Further, material data used for the numerical analysis and measured by authors are included in the csv file and all necessary input codes for the FE system Ansys creating data for graphs in the publication are provided in the subfolder "Models-Ansys" within "Data" directory.
